One of the unique features of BuildingConnected is that it functions as a network. If you are a subcontractor invited to bid on a project by a General Contractor using the software, you generally do not need to pay for a license to view the project or submit your bid. You simply need to create a free account to view the invitation. free download buildingconnected

Subcontractors can create a free account to join the network, manage their bid board, and receive invitations to bid (ITBs) directly from general contractors.

That’s because BuildingConnected is a cloud-based platform owned by Autodesk. You don’t download a large file to your desktop; you access it through your browser.
